If you have clay soil in your garden, you know that it can be a challenge to grow plants. Clay soil is heavy and dense, which makes it difficult for water and air to penetrate. This can lead to problems with drainage, root rot, and stunted plant growth.
There are a number of ways to improve clay soil, but one of the best is to use a clay cutter soil amendment. Clay cutters are a type of soil amendment that helps to break up the clay particles and improve the drainage and aeration of the soil. This makes it easier for plants to get the water and air they need to thrive.

Benefits of Using Clay Cutter Soil Amendment:
There are many benefits to using clay cutter soil amendment, including:
- Improved drainage: Clay cutters help to break up the clay particles, which makes it easier for water to drain through the soil. This can help to prevent waterlogging and root rot.
- Improved aeration: Clay cutters also help to improve the aeration of the soil, which means that more oxygen can reach the roots of plants. This is essential for healthy plant growth.
- Increased water retention: Clay cutters can help to increase the water retention capacity of the soil. This means that plants will be less likely to dry out during hot, dry weather.
- Improved nutrient availability: Clay cutters can help to improve the availability of nutrients in the soil. This is because they break up the clay particles, which makes it easier for roots to absorb nutrients.
How to Use Clay Cutter Soil Amendment:
To use clay cutter soil amendment, simply spread it evenly over the soil surface. You can then use a garden tiller to incorporate it into the soil. The amount of clay cutter you need to use will depend on the severity of your clay problem.
